Default V./B. water report

My job got rained out from yesterdays rain,so My son and I headed out to the pass this afternoon. I knew as soon as I saw the whitecaps in the cove it wasnt going to be pleasant on the outside(where the reefs are). Headed through the pass,and it looked like poo.Hit a couple of reefs,the water was only slightly better there,but was too windy to really fish. Winds were about 15 mph. and 2' with occasional 3' swells. Anchored off and got a few bites, but that was about it. Hung a nice red around the island. Didnt stay real long,didnt feel like fighting it if it wasnt going to happen. Im sure someone will hammer em tomorrow. Thats usually how it is in the v./b.
